The real 2-year cost of Johnson College

Over the 15 years from 2008 to 2023, published tuition and required fees at Johnson College went from $14,630 to $20,733, an average of 1.9% a year.

If you pay full sticker

Projected tuition + fees, entering fall 2026.

Year 1$21,932
Year 2$22,347
2-year total$44,279

Two aid scenarios

2-year out-of-pocket total.

$10,000/yr flat scholarship
$24,279
Flat aid doesn't grow, so it covers less each year.
50%-of-tuition scholarship
$24,622
Percentage aid keeps pace with tuition.
